If you use the cPanel username and password, you can connect directly to your servers “ Home” directory. You DO NOT have to create an FTP account to connect to your server. With FTP, you can upload all your files to your server at once. InMotion Hosting has the cPanel File Manager that you can use to upload files to your server however, the File Manager requires you to upload one file at a time.
